Here's some steps I posted in the Group Buy thread if you're interested:


I'm not a professional installer nor do I have vast experience in tint. But here are some of my steps which may or may not help others attempting this:

Useful Items

  • Plastic squeegee that came with the tint
  • Spray bottle with water/dishwashing liquid mix
  • Hair dryer or heat gun
  • Phillips screwdriver
  • Extremely sharp razor/blade
  • Towel
  • Surface cleaners

Let's Get Started

  1. I found it much easier to work on the taillights while they were lying flat on a solid surface. That way I didn't have to worry about scratching, wetting, or blemishing the car. So I recommend removing the taillights if you have time. It's quite simple. Just unfasten the shopping bag hooks (rotate until it's upside down, and jam a small screwdriver in the hole to un-do it), peel back the lining, and then unscrew the x4 nuts holding the taillights in place. After disconnecting the wire harness, simply pull the taillight out.
  2. Place the taillight on top of the towel while in a nice comfortable area, preferably inside the house where it's warm!
  3. Flip the taillight over onto it's surface. There are x2 screws that hold that chrome strip in place. Unscrew those and remove the chrome strip.
  4. Clean the taillight surface thoroughly with the surface cleaners
  5. Peel the tint film from the paper backing, being sure to hold it by one of the square tabs sticking out. This will prevent finger prints on the film!
  6. As markii suggested before, use a blend of water with a bit of dishwashing liquid for the spray bottle, and spray generously on both the taillight surface and the tint film (the sticky part).
  7. Lay the tint film on the taillight and align it so that no areas are exposed. You should have about 5-10mm of excess film at the borders. The water/soap mix should allow the tint to move about freely without being stuck to the taillight
  8. Going from one side to the other or from the centre out to the edge, use the squeegee to start pushing out the water between the two layers. Use the hair dryer to quicken this process. As the water is evacuated and the tint film starts to dry, it will start to stick to the taillight. Also use the squeegee to squeeze out any air pockets to the edge.
  9. Keep the hair drying running constantly as you're squeezing out the water and air, as it will help evaporate the water but also soften the tint film. There's a curve in the taillight, and heated film will be soft and adhere to that curve better.
  10. At the edges where you have excess film, there will be air pockets as the film tends to curl up. Just keep focusing on the other areas until they are relatively bubble free.
  11. With the main area finished, take the sharp razo/blade and run it at the edges, cutting the excess film. If you didn't remove the chrome strip, the bottom part gets a bit difficult.
  12. With the excess trimmed, run the squeegee and hair dryer through the edges again, this time it should be more cooperative.
  13. Re-install the chrome strip
  14. Re-install the taillights and re-connect the wire harness
  15. Sit back, relax, and admire your efforts.
  16. Now take some damn pics and post it up on this forum or we will kill you.

If you notice any haze or milky areas, this is normal as it occurs in the tinting of windows as well. It should eventually disappear after a while. Air pockets should go away as well. Usually within 1-3 weeks.
